GOVERNORSHIP OF BELIZE
1. In your minute of 15 February 1979 to Miss Falconer (copy to me) you refer to the Governorship of Belize as having been "temporarily upgraded to DS3 equivalent on an ad hominen basis” You went on to say that you expected the post to revert to DS4 when the present Governor retired at the end of the year.
2. I attach copies of minutes from Messrs Collins, Posnett, Shakespeare and Cortazzi written when this upgrading was being recommended and all refer to the post of Governor-not merely the present incumbent. Your own Head of Department's letter of 16 October 1978 refers to the additional political responsibility that has accrued to the post since it was graded DS4 in 1974. Mr Trainer of CSD in his reply of 27 October 1978 agreed that these responsibilities justified upgrading the post. The same letter asked us to keep possible reversion in mind if at some time in the future the situation in Belize were to change but our understanding is that the additional responsibilities caused by the Guatamalan situation which justified upgrading of the post will not have receded by the time ir McEntee goes. We, therefore, plan on locating a DS3 (or equivalent) to replace
him.
